On Sunday 24th January, three group stunts headed to Legacy Cheer and Dance in Newcastle to compete in the regional event. After only one week of training following the Christmas holidays, sessions had been long, tiring and for some groups, very early!

After a detour back to Durham to pick up a forgotten uniform, we were finally in warm up and ready to take to the floor. Despite the nerves before their first performance together as a stunt group, Defiance put in a super performance followed by Destiny whose routine was one of their best to date. However, as their routine finished, injury struck for our level 3 co-ed group, resulting in them being unable to compete again later in the day.

Despite concern for a fellow squad member, the show had to go on and Dynamite went on to perform their first level 4 routine this year, executing some very advanced skills under difficult circumstances.

Following a second performance from both our all-girl level 3 and co-ed level 4 teams, it was time for results. Destiny came 3rd place in their division, whilst Dynamite achieved 2nd place. Defiance were then awarded winners in the all-girl level 3 category, ending what had been a day of very mixed emotions on a high!

A huge congratulations to everyone who competed - you all performed incredibly! Can’t wait for our next competition when the level 2 co-ed squad will be competing for the first time this year!
